titleOfInvention A kind of Fenton iron mud cathode and anode integrated ceramsite and method for preparing ceramsite by using Fenton iron mud
abstract The invention relates to an integrated cathode and anode ceramsite of Fenton iron mud and a method for preparing ceramsite by using Fenton iron mud. ~8 parts, fly ash 0.1~1 part, pelletizing agent 0.1~1 part, the binder is clay; the water absorption rate of the ceramsite is 5~10%, and the particle density is 1000~1600kg/ m3 , the bulk density is 500~750kg/m 3 . The ceramsite of the invention integrates the cathode and the anode, and has its own cathode and anode, with rough surface, large specific surface area, low water absorption, low particle density and high porosity.
